If you encounter a barrier while browsing, reading content, or trying to complete a purchase, contact us with as much detail as possible.
Tell us which page or feature caused the issue.
Describe what happened and what you expected to happen instead.
If possible, include the device, browser, or assistive technology you were using.
Send the report to our support team so we can review and respond.
